1 INTRODUCTION
1.1 Description
The MLiS MLB-G1103 is a LTE wireless terminal. It is designed for RS232/RS422/RS485 communication
over TCP/IP via any readily available LTE carrier network. Overall, they are more cost and time effective
to use remote solutions to combine Machine to Machine over diverse locations without having first to
establish and invest in a huge complex network.
The MLB-G1103 wireless terminal series use the DB9 Connector to provide data communication
interface and the DC jack to provide power input. LEDs are used to indicate the status of the wireless
terminal.
The MLB-G1103 wireless terminal can be used to provide a wireless communication link to many
applications, including metering, fleet and asset management, vending, security and alarm monitoring,
e-maintenance and other telemetry applications.

Functional Block Diagram
Figure 1-1: Functional Block Diagram for MLB-G1103
The MLB-G1103 series consist of a fully certified (CE /NCC approved) GSM/GPRS engine, SIM card
holder and power regulator.
The wireless terminal is supplied with power via the DC jack. The remaining DB9 connector is used for
data communications.
The SMA female connector provides the air interface to an external 50 ohm antenna specified for the
correct frequency band.
1.3 Precautions
The MLB-G1103 wireless terminals are designed for indoor use only. For outdoor uses it has to be
integrated into a weatherproof enclosure. Do not exceed the environmental and electrical limits as
specified in the user manual.

The RESET button is located on the bottom panel of the MLB-G1103. You can reboot the MLB-G1103 or
reset it to default settings by pressing the RESET button with a pointed object such as an unfolded
paper clip.
Configuration Mode: Double click RESET button to enter configuration mode and the signal LEDs
will become marquee mode.
Reboot: Hold the RESET button down for under 5 seconds and then release.
Reset to Default: Hold the RESET button down for over 5 seconds until the LEDs are off. Release
the button to reset the MLB-G1103 and enter the boot-up stage.

MLB-G1103 LTE Wireless Terminal User Manual 14 Rev 1.1
3.4 SIM Card Holder
In the bottom, The MLB-G1103 wireless terminals are provided with a SIM card reader designed for
1.8V and 3V SIM cards. It is the flip-up type which can be locked. It can be accessed through removing
the cover as shown below.
Figure 6: SIM Card Holder for MLB-G1103
Be sure to power off the modem when user replaces the SIM card. Otherwise it may cause
damage to the equipment.
The MLB-G1103 series fully operate when inserting a SIM card. Some MLB-G1103 series’ functionality
may be lost if the users try to operate the wireless terminal without a SIM card.

3.6 Getting Started
HW Installation
Step 1: Please insert SIM card into SIM card holder as follows.
Be sure to power off the modem when user replaces the SIM card. Otherwise it may cause
damage to the equipment.
Installing a SIM Card
The SIM card slots are located inside the MLB-G1103’s housing. To install a SIM card, please follow the
steps below:
1. Turn off the MLB-G1103.
2. Remove the screw to open the SIM card slot cover.
3. Install a SIM card into a SIM card flip-up holder.
Orient the gold contacts facing down and the cut-off edge to the left.
4. Install the screw to secure the SIM card slot cover.

Step 3: Please connect power supplier with 5~42 VDC, then boot up. The LED will light up when MLB-
G1103 Series ready.
Step 4: After plug-in power adapter. The wireless terminal is usually fully operational within 30
seconds, after powering it up. Depending on the signal strength of the network in the area, logging into
a network may take longer and is outside the control of the wireless terminal.
The device is ready after LED of signal is lighted. Then user can operate it.

MLB-G1103 LTE Wireless Terminal User Manual 19 Rev 1.1
Step 5: When user uses the MCCU (MLiS Cellular Configuration Utility) to configure MLB-G1103, please
refer the connection as below:
Note: The user needs to use null modem adaptor, DB9 Female to DB9 Female connector so
RS-232 console management is workable from PC via RS-232 console cable.
